In the figure, BE||CD, B is the midpoint of AC, and E is the midpoint of AD
Answer:
A. 8
Step-by-step explanation:
BE = ½(CD) (midsegment theorem)
BE = 2x - 10
CD = 12
Plug in the values
2x - 10 = ½(12)
2x - 10 = 6
Add 10 to both sides
2x - 10 + 10 = 6 + 10 (addition property of equality)
2x = 16 (addition property of equality)
Divide both sides by 2
2x/2 = 16/2
x = 8 (division property of equality)

Lincoln is building a wooden garage door in the shape of a rectangle with a width of 16 ft and a height of 8 feet. Lincoln is going to place two boards in the shape of an x on the door. How many feet of materials will he need for the X?
Answer:
Length of material needed = 35.8 feet
Step-by-step explanation:
Door of the wooden garage is in the shape of a rectangle with dimensions 16 ft × 8 ft.
Lincoln is going to place two boards in the shape of an X on the door.
From the picture attached,
Diagonals of the rectangular door will be equal in measure.
Therefore, length of the material = 2×(Diagonal of the rectangle)
By applying Pythagoras theorem in the rectangle,
(Diagonal)² = 16² + 8²
Diagonal = \(\sqrt{256+64}\) = 17.89
Therefore, length of material = 2 × 17.89
= 35.77
≈ 35.8 feet

If 3sinθ + 4cosθ = 5, Prove that tanθ= 3/4.
I'll use x in place of θ
Let's isolate the sine term and then square both sides
3sin(x) + 4cos(x) = 5
3sin(x) = 5-4cos(x)
(3sin(x))^2 = ( 5-4cos(x) )^2
9sin^2(x) = 25-40cos(x)+16cos^2(x)
9sin^2(x) = 25-40cos(x)+16(1-sin^2(x))
9sin^2(x) = 25-40cos(x)+16-16sin^2(x)
9sin^2(x)+16sin^2(x) = 25-40cos(x)+16
25sin^2(x) = 41-40cos(x)
25(1-cos^2(x)) = 41-40cos(x)
25-25cos^2(x) = 41-40cos(x)
Now let w = cos(x), so we now have the following
25-25w^2 = 41-40w
25w^2-40w+41-25 = 0
25w^2-40w+16 = 0
(5w - 4)^2 = 0
5w-4 = 0
w = 4/5
Therefore cos(x) = 4/5
Use the pythagorean theorem or unit circle to find that if cos(x) = 4/5, then it leads to sin(x) = 3/5. This is exactly because of the 3-4-5 right triangle.
Then lastly,
tan(x) = sin(x)/cos(x)
tan(x) = sin(x) ÷ cos(x)
tan(x) = (3/5) ÷ (4/5)
tan(x) = (3/5) * (5/4)
tan(x) = (3*5)/(5*4)
tan(x) = 3/4

What’s the 6th term of 23,92,368
Answer:
23552
Step-by-step explanation:
23, 92, 368... is a geometric sequence.
first term = a = 23
common ratio = r = 2 term ÷ first term = 92 ÷ 23 = 4
nth term = \(ar^n^-^1\)
6th term = \(23*(4)^6^-^1\)
\(=23*4^5\)
\(=23*1024\)
\(=23552\)
